> Refactor the Network function inline packet-flow tests so they run
> reliably under parallel load:
> 
> - Drop TAG_UNSTABLE and remove static sleep.
> 
> - Extract the helper functions shared by the four NF packet-flow
>   tests into an NF_HELPERS m4 macro (nf_setup_hypervisors,
>   nf_teardown_hypervisors, nf_test_icmp, nf_create_port_binding,
>   nf_cleanup_port_binding).
> 
> - Tear down and recreate hypervisors between subtests so each
>   subtest starts with fresh datapath state, avoiding flakiness
>   caused by state left over from the previous chassis binding,
>   such as timing issues while FDB entries are relearned.
> 
> - Add OVN_CLEAR_ARP_TABLE macro (tests/ovn-macros.at) used by
>   nf_teardown_hypervisors to reset the ARP table populated by
>   ovn_attach().
